As the repair progresses, it can become difficult to see where the glass was scratched. So you always know where you should be working, mark the scratched area. The easiest way to do this is by outlining the scratch with a dry-erase marker on the opposite (undamaged) side of the glass.

Baking soda mixed with water is touted as a quick fix for phone screen scratches, but does it work? Thanks to its similarly abrasive nature, it turns out that this method is about the same as toothpaste as far as results go. It’ll take care of marks decently enough on plastic covers and screen protectors, but definitely not glass. roth rollover deadlineWebHow To Fix Minor Scratches at Home. 1.
